iHeartMedia's 24/7 News Network Joins Forces With NBC News To Launch "NBC News Radio"

New Collaboration with NBC News Brings its Content to Thousands of Broadcast and Digital Radio Stations Across the U.S.

New York – July 11, 2016 – iHeartMedia today announced that its 24/7 News Network, the world's largest radio-only news source, will provide its 1,000 affiliated radio stations and iHeartMedia's more than 850 radio stations with access to NBC News broadcast coverage, along with an hourly newscast provided to its network around the clock. In addition, iHeartRadio, iHeartMedia's all-in-one digital music and streaming radio service, will also feature “NBC News Radio” as a source for national and international news content.

Through this collaboration, NBC News will now span all media platforms including the most widely consumed medium, Radio, which reaches 93 percent of Americans each week. Global content from NBC News' leading and award-winning television news broadcasts including primetime specials, political events and breaking news reports will be available to all of iHeartMedia's 24/7 News Network affiliates, owned stations and will stream online via a new "NBC News Radio" station on iHeartRadio.

“We couldn’t be more excited to partner with NBC News in providing our affiliates and listeners with award-winning news coverage along with the global reach of this powerful news organization,” said Chris Berry, Senior Vice President and General Manager of 24/7 News Network. “Plus, the addition of NBC News Radio on iHeartRadio showcases both our companies’ commitment to providing our consumers with the most credible news wherever they are, whenever they want it.”

“We are delighted to team up with industry leader iHeartMedia to bring the influential reporting of NBC News to radio listeners across the country,” said Elisabeth Sami, SVP, NBC News Group. “More Americans watch NBC News than any news organization in the world, and now millions more will be able to listen to it on iHeartRadio stations.”

With bureaus and staff correspondents throughout the United States, 24/7 News Network produces content solely for radio with anchored news, sports and weather reports serving more than 1,000 broadcast radio stations as well as digital radio affiliates via the iHeartRadio platform.

About NBC News
More Americans watch NBC News than any news organization in the world. NBC News is a global leader in news across all broadcast and digital platforms. Its leading and award-winning television news broadcasts include NBC Nightly News with Lester Holt, TODAY, Meet the Press, and Dateline, as well as primetime specials and breaking news reports. The rapidly-growing NBC News Digital Group, along with the SiriusXM TODAY Show Radio channel, provide continuous content to consumers wherever they are, whenever they want it. NBC News also operates Peacock Productions, an award-winning in-house production company, and the NBC NewsChannel affiliate news service.

NBC News is part of the NBCUniversal News Group, a division of NBCUniversal, which is owned by Comcast Corporation. For more information about NBCUniversal, please visit www.NBCUniversal.com.

About iHeartMedia, Inc.

iHeartMedia (NASDAQ: IHRT) is the number one audio company in the United States, reaching nine out of 10 Americans every month. It consists of three business groups.

With its quarter of a billion monthly listeners, the iHeartMedia Multiplatform Group has a greater reach than any other media company in the U.S. Its leadership position in audio extends across multiple platforms, including more than 860 live broadcast stations in over 160 markets nationwide; its National Sales organization; and the company’s live and virtual events business. It also includes Premiere Networks, the industry’s largest Networks business, with its Total Traffic and Weather Network (TTWN); and BIN: Black Information Network, the first and only 24/7 national and local all news audio service for the Black community. iHeartMedia also leads the audio industry in analytics, targeting and attribution for its marketing partners with its SmartAudio suite of data targeting and attribution products using data from its massive consumer base.

The iHeartMedia Digital Audio Group includes the company’s fast-growing podcasting business -- iHeartMedia is the number one podcast publisher in downloads, unique listeners, revenue and earnings -- as well as its industry-leading iHeartRadio digital service, available across more than 500 platforms and 2,000 devices; the company’s digital sites, newsletters, digital services and programs; its digital advertising technology companies; and its audio industry-leading social media footprint.

The company’s Audio & Media Services reportable segment includes Katz Media Group, the nation’s largest media representation company, and RCS, the world's leading provider of broadcast and webcast software.
